Question

Alex wants to draw two triangles ABC and DEF, such that:
AB = DE
BC= EF
C=F
We have AB = 5 cm, BC = 6 cm and C=60. Can you construct the two triangles and are the two triangles congruent? Give reasons for your answer.

Open in App
Solution

Yes, we can construct the two triangles, the two triangles are not congruent.

Here, the two triangles are not congruent because for congruency, the angles which are equal should have been the included angles, B and E.

If there are two triangles given with equal sides and an equal angle which is non-included angle, then the two triangles are not congruent.

However, if we are given a triangle with 2 sides and a non-included angle, we can construct a triangle with that information.
